Chester is located in Delaware County, Pennsylvania with a population of 33,972 residents. The area was once inhabited by the Okehocking Indian tribe, who were displaced from their lands in 1702 by the directive of William Penn, and the region’s original indigenous name was Mecoponaca. The settlement’s history dates back to 1644 when Swedish settlers established it under the name “Upland,” later renamed Chester in 1682. It achieved incorporation as a borough on October 31, 1701, and attained city status on February 14, 1866, making it the oldest city in Pennsylvania.

Chester Fire Fighters – The City of Chester currently owns and operates two fire stations, Station 81 and Station 82. These stations are manned 24 hours a day 7 days a week by a fully paid staff. Prior to the two city owned fire houses there were 5 volunteer fire companies with paid drivers that provided the fire protection services for the city.
